Latest Patents
Muraoka's latest patents include an image recording apparatus and a printing plate material. The image recording apparatus utilizes a sheet printing plate material that features a plastic support with optical transparency for infrared light. This innovative material includes a hydrophilic layer and a thermosensitive image formed layer, which are essential for its functionality. The sheet printing plate material is designed to be wound on a drum with a surface reflectance of 0.1 to 10% at the wavelength used. This setup allows for the rotation of the drum to expose image data with a light source, effectively recording images.
His second patent, the printing plate producing machine, further showcases his expertise in this domain.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Muraoka has worked with prominent companies such as Konica Minolta Medical and Graphic, Inc. and Dainippon Screen Mfg. Co., Ltd. His experience in these organizations has contributed to his development as an inventor and innovator in the field.
